Thanks.. Lots of people roast, cook and grill in a WFO, even whole pigs, so im not worried about it. These oven can get over 900F, any oil or over spills easily will burn off. Having said that you dont want to intentionally spill food and oil all over the place, you should have pans under your food, when grilling, you would either use a cast iron pan or a Tuscan style grill, and have coals under the grill, any spill the heat will just burn it up.
